Poor Prognosis in Critical Limb Ischemia Without Pre-Onset Intermittent Claudication

Patients lacking symptoms of intermittent claudication (IC) before critical limb ischemia (CLI) have unique characteristics and a higher risk of poor outcomes, including lower amputation-free survival.
Area of Science:
- Vascular Surgery
- Ischemic Limb Disease
- Patient Outcomes
Background:
- Critical limb ischemia (CLI) can occur without prior symptoms of intermittent claudication (IC).
- The outcomes for CLI patients without a history of IC are not well understood.
- This study investigates the characteristics and prognosis of CLI patients who did not experience IC prior to diagnosis.
Purpose of the Study:
- To compare outcomes between patients with critical limb ischemia (CLI) with and without a history of intermittent claudication (IC).
- To identify unique features and risk factors associated with CLI in patients lacking prior IC symptoms.
- To determine if the absence of IC is an independent predictor of poor outcomes in CLI patients.
Main Methods:
- Retrospective analysis of 225 patients (265 limbs) with CLI, divided into non-IC (142 patients) and IC (83 patients) groups.
- Comparison of comorbid factors, revascularization rates, and clinical outcomes between the two groups.
- Cox regression analysis to identify independent risk factors for amputation-free survival.
Main Results:
- Patients without prior IC were more likely to have diabetes, hypoalbuminemia, advanced disease (Rutherford's classification), and worse ambulatory function.
- A higher proportion of the non-IC group failed arterial revascularization due to disease progression or infection.
- Amputation-free survival was significantly lower in the non-IC group compared to the IC group.
Conclusions:
- Patients presenting with CLI without prior IC symptoms exhibit distinct clinical characteristics.
- The absence of intermittent claudication is an independent risk factor associated with poorer outcomes in critical limb ischemia.
- These findings highlight the need for tailored management strategies for CLI patients without preceding IC.
